By stress relief heat treatment?

Stress relief is a therapy Heating a metal or alloy to a predetermined temperature below its lower transformation temperature Then cool in air. The main purpose is to relieve the stress absorbed by the metal during forming, straightening, machining or rolling etc.

What is your temperature for stress relief?

The stress relief temperature is usually between 550 and 650°C For steel parts. Soaking time is about one to two hours. After the soaking time, the components should be cooled slowly in the oven or in the air.

What is the difference between annealing and normalizing?

The main difference between annealing and normalizing is that Annealing allows the material to cool at a controlled rate in the furnace. Normalizing can be cooled by placing the material in a room temperature environment and exposing it to air in that environment.

Is stress relief the same as annealing?

Stress relief can considered a category of annealing. In stress relief, the workpiece is heat treated at a lower temperature (below the recrystallization or transformation temperature) for the sole purpose of removing internal residual stresses from previous forming operations.

What is the difference between Pwht and decompression?

Post Weld Heat Treatment (PWHT) or sometimes called stress relief is a method For reducing and redistributing residual stress in material introduced by welding.
